Public Shoreline Beach West of Whitefish Point is nestled within the Lake Superior State Forest, approximately 3.5 miles west of Whitefish Point. This scenic beach offers a serene escape with its natural beauty and tranquil atmosphere. Located in the Upper Peninsula of Michigan, it provides stunning views of Lake Superior and is a great spot for relaxation and nature exploration. The area is known for its rich history and proximity to the famous Whitefish Point Lighthouse, which marks the entry into Whitefish Bay.

Visitors can enjoy the peaceful surroundings, engage in activities like birdwatching, or explore the nearby attractions such as the Great Lakes Shipwreck Museum. The beach is accessible via public roads, making it a convenient destination for those seeking a secluded yet accessible natural retreat.

The region's unique blend of natural beauty and historical significance makes it an appealing destination for both nature lovers and history enthusiasts.

One of the most fascinating aspects of Public Shoreline Beach West of Whitefish Point is its proximity to the infamous SS Edmund Fitzgerald shipwreck, which lies about 17 miles offshore. The area is often referred to as the 'Graveyard of the Great Lakes' due to the numerous shipwrecks that have occurred here over the centuries.

The Whitefish Point Underwater Preserve protects many of these shipwrecks, making it a unique spot for divers and history enthusiasts. The beach itself offers breathtaking views of Lake Superior, and on clear days, visitors can see Canada about 20 miles away.

The combination of natural beauty, historical significance, and the presence of the Whitefish Point Bird Observatory make this area a fascinating destination for exploration and discovery.

Public Shoreline Beach West of Whitefish Point is surrounded by several notable attractions that enhance its appeal. The Whitefish Point Lighthouse, located nearby, is the oldest operating lighthouse on Lake Superior and offers stunning views of the lake. The Great Lakes Shipwreck Museum is another major draw, featuring artifacts from shipwrecks, including the bell from the Edmund Fitzgerald.

The Whitefish Point Bird Observatory is a must-visit for bird enthusiasts, as it is a significant migratory route for over 340 species of birds. Additionally, the Tahquamenon Falls, located about a half hour south, provide a beautiful natural spectacle with its vibrant colors and scenic hiking trails.

These attractions combine to make the area a rich destination for both nature lovers and those interested in maritime history.
